Это - то, что делает система песочницы хинду. Это не особенно хорошо документируется, и я не уверен, как трудный это должно было бы получить работу нехинду системы, но это, вероятно, выполнимо.
Можно получить текущую стабильную версию здесь и посмотреть в etc/sandbox.conf, чтобы видеть, как настроить его.
Одна вещь, ls
попытки к stat()
каждый файл в рамках каталога (который включает, в этом случае, корень каждой смонтированной файловой системы), которого ни одной из команд Вы делали попытку успешно, делает так. Таким образом, проблема вероятна с одной из смонтированных файловых систем, а не с /mnt
самостоятельно.
Для знания больше необходимо выяснить, в каких файловых системах Вы смонтировались /mnt
, и судите каждого из них индивидуально (ls -d /mnt/foo
) видеть, какой вызывает проблему.
ls -d
все в/mnt, по одному, ни один из них не замораживается? И если Выls /mnt
снова все еще замораживается снова? – Random832 29.10.2012, 21:32strace ls
, это обходит Ваши псевдонимы оболочки. У Вас, вероятно, есть псевдоним, который вызываетls
на самом деле выполнитьсяls --color=auto
или некоторые такой. Причины псевдонимаls
к статистике каждая запись каталога; пустоеls /mnt
не делает. – Gilles 'SO- stop being evil' 30.10.2012, 00:41